Richard Fangnail

In XP, can you set up chkdsk so it runs automatically if the last shut
down was abnormal? Scandisk with earlier Windows could do that.

I recently had a problem which might have been prevented if chkdsk had
started automatically.

chkdsk always runs if the disk was dirty at the time of the unexpected
shutdown.
